Haydale, a leader in the development of enhanced graphene and other nanomaterials looks set to form a collaborative agreement with Alex Thomson Racing (ATR) the HUGO BOSS sponsored extreme sailing team.

Through its newly acquired subsidiary EPL Composite Solutions Limited, Haydale will work with ATR to improve overall strength and stiffness of a number of key structures while also keeping the vessel light for optimum speed. The project is particularly focused on the use of modified Carbon Fibre Reinforced Plastic  and epoxy resin  materials containing functionalised HDPlas® Graphene Nano Platelets.

Stewart Hosford, Managing Director of Alex Thomson Racing added:

''It is exciting to be using such industry leading technology in our Research and Development programme. It is important that we deliver a vessel that has the strength to race around the world, but keeps the weight of HUGO BOSS to a minimum. It is similar to Formula One in that you need to keep the vessel light to ensure optimum speed without a compromise on strength, providing the results for the title sponsor whilst racing. I am looking forward to seeing the results and using this technology in future design concepts.''
